Blender 是一款功能强大且完全免费的开源三维创作套件,它集建模、雕刻、动画、渲染、视频剪辑和游戏开发于一体。对于初学者来说,Blender 的界面和功能可能显得有些复杂,但通过系统性的学习和实践,任何人都可以掌握它。本指南将从零开始,逐步引导你从 Blender 的基础操作到高级建模技巧,最终达到精通水平。

第一部分:Blender 基础入门

1.1 Blender 简介与安装

Blender 是由 Blender 基金会开发的开源软件,支持 Windows、macOS 和 Linux 系统。它完全免费,无需订阅,且拥有活跃的社区和丰富的插件生态。

安装步骤:

  1. 访问 Blender 官方网站(blender.org)。
  2. 下载适合你操作系统的最新版本(推荐 LTS 版本,稳定性高)。
  3. 运行安装程序,按照提示完成安装。
  4. 启动 Blender,你会看到默认的启动界面,包含一个立方体、相机和灯光。

1.2 界面与基本操作

Blender 的界面由多个区域组成,包括 3D 视图、大纲视图、属性面板和时间轴等。

核心区域:

  • 3D 视图(3D Viewport):主要工作区,用于查看和编辑场景。
  • 大纲视图(Outliner):显示场景中所有对象的列表。
  • 属性面板(Properties Panel):调整对象、材质、渲染等设置。
  • 时间轴(Timeline):用于动画制作。

基本操作:

  • 视图导航
    • 中键拖动:平移视图。
    • 滚轮:缩放视图。
    • Shift + 中键拖动:旋转视图。
  • 对象操作
    • 选择对象:左键单击。
    • 移动(G)、旋转(R)、缩放(S):选中对象后按相应快捷键。
    • 删除对象:选中后按 X 键。
  • 编辑模式
    • 按 Tab 键在对象模式和编辑模式之间切换。
    • 编辑模式下,可以对顶点、边和面进行操作。

1.3 第一个简单项目:创建一个杯子

让我们通过一个简单的例子来熟悉 Blender 的基本操作。

步骤:

  1. 删除默认立方体:选中立方体,按 X 键,选择“Delete”。
  2. 添加圆柱体:按 Shift + A,选择“Mesh” > “Cylinder”。
  3. 调整圆柱体:按 S 键缩放,按 G 键移动,使其看起来像一个杯子的底部。
  4. 进入编辑模式:按 Tab 键。
  5. 选择顶部面:按 3 键(面选择模式),点击顶部面。
  6. 按 E 键挤出面,向上移动鼠标,形成杯壁。
  7. 按 S 键缩放顶部面,使其略微缩小,形成杯口。
  8. 添加细分修改器:在属性面板中,点击“修改器”图标(扳手),添加“细分曲面”修改器,设置视图细分级别为 2。
  9. 应用修改器:点击“应用”按钮(或按 Ctrl + A 应用变换)。
  10. 渲染预览:按 F12 键渲染,查看效果。

通过这个简单的项目,你已经学会了添加对象、编辑几何体和使用修改器。

第二部分:中级建模技巧

2.1 多边形建模基础

多边形建模是 Blender 中最常用的建模方法,通过编辑顶点、边和面来创建复杂形状。

关键技巧:

  • 环切(Loop Cut):按 Ctrl + R 在边上添加环切线,用于增加几何细节。
  • 挤出(Extrude):按 E 键挤出面或边,创建新几何体。
  • 内插面(Inset):按 I 键在面内插入新面,常用于创建边框或细节。
  • 倒角(Bevel):按 Ctrl + B 键对边进行倒角,使边缘更平滑。

示例:创建一个简单的桌子

  1. 添加一个立方体(Shift + A > Mesh > Cube)。
  2. 进入编辑模式(Tab)。
  3. 选择顶部面,按 E 键挤出,然后按 S 键缩放,创建桌面。
  4. 选择底部面,按 E 键挤出,然后按 S 键缩放,创建桌腿。
  5. 使用环切(Ctrl + R)在桌腿上添加细节。
  6. 选择桌腿的底部面,按 E 键挤出,然后按 S 键缩放,创建脚垫。
  7. 为桌面添加倒角:选择桌面的边缘,按 Ctrl + B 键,拖动鼠标调整倒角大小。

2.2 修改器的使用

修改器是非破坏性建模的强大工具,可以实时调整效果而不改变原始几何体。

常用修改器:

  • 细分曲面(Subdivision Surface):平滑几何体,增加细节。
  • 阵列(Array):复制对象,创建重复结构。
  • 布尔(Boolean):通过交集、并集或差集组合对象。
  • 镜像(Mirror):对称建模,节省时间。

示例:使用阵列修改器创建栏杆

  1. 创建一个圆柱体作为栏杆的支柱(Shift + A > Mesh > Cylinder)。
  2. 调整圆柱体的大小和形状。
  3. 添加阵列修改器:在属性面板中,点击“修改器”图标,选择“Array”。
  4. 设置数量为 10,沿 X 轴偏移 1.5。
  5. 添加曲线修改器:创建一个曲线(Shift + A > Curve > Bezier Curve),调整曲线形状。
  6. 添加曲线修改器到圆柱体:选择圆柱体,添加“Curve”修改器,选择创建的曲线。
  7. 调整曲线形状,栏杆会随之弯曲。

2.3 雕刻建模

雕刻建模适用于有机形状,如角色、动物或自然物体。

步骤:

  1. 创建一个基础网格(如球体)。
  2. 进入雕刻模式:在 3D 视图的左上角,将模式从“对象模式”改为“雕刻模式”。
  3. 选择笔刷:Blender 提供多种笔刷,如“Clay Strips”、“Smooth”、“Grab”等。
  4. 调整笔刷设置:在右侧属性面板中,调整强度、半径和流量。
  5. 开始雕刻:使用笔刷推拉表面,塑造形状。

示例:雕刻一个简单的石头

  1. 添加一个球体(Shift + A > Mesh > Sphere)。
  2. 进入雕刻模式。
  3. 选择“Clay Strips”笔刷,强度设为 0.5,半径设为 0.1。
  4. 在球体表面绘制,创建凹凸不平的纹理。
  5. 使用“Smooth”笔刷平滑某些区域。
  6. 使用“Grab”笔刷调整整体形状。
  7. 完成雕刻后,返回对象模式,添加细分曲面修改器平滑表面。

第三部分:高级建模技巧

3.1 高级多边形建模

高级多边形建模涉及复杂形状的创建,如角色、机械零件等。

技巧:

  • 桥接循环边(Bridge Edge Loops):连接两个循环边,创建平滑过渡。
  • 填充(Fill):使用 F 键填充选中的边或面。
  • 网格清理(Mesh Cleanup):使用“Merge by Distance”合并顶点,删除重复几何体。

示例:创建一个简单的角色头部

  1. 创建一个立方体(Shift + A > Mesh > Cube)。
  2. 进入编辑模式,选择所有面,按 S 键缩放,使其更接近球形。
  3. 使用环切(Ctrl + R)添加细节,如眼睛和嘴巴的位置。
  4. 选择面部区域,按 E 键挤出,创建鼻子。
  5. 使用桥接循环边连接鼻子和面部。
  6. 添加眼睛:创建两个球体,调整位置和大小。
  7. 使用布尔修改器或手动建模创建嘴巴。
  8. 添加细分曲面修改器,平滑表面。

3.2 UV 展开与纹理贴图

UV 展开是将 3D 模型表面映射到 2D 平面的过程,用于纹理贴图。

步骤:

  1. 选择模型,进入编辑模式。
  2. 选择所有面,按 U 键,选择“Unwrap”。
  3. 在 UV 编辑器中查看展开的 UV。
  4. 调整 UV 布局,避免重叠。
  5. 创建纹理:在图像编辑器中新建图像,或导入现有纹理。
  6. 为模型添加材质:在属性面板中,点击“材质”图标,新建材质。
  7. 在着色器编辑器中,连接“图像纹理”节点到“基础色”。
  8. 选择图像,调整 UV 映射。

示例:为杯子添加纹理

  1. 创建杯子模型(如第一部分所述)。
  2. 进入编辑模式,选择所有面,按 U 键,选择“Unwrap”。
  3. 在 UV 编辑器中,调整 UV 布局。
  4. 在图像编辑器中,新建图像(如 512x512 像素)。
  5. 在着色器编辑器中,添加“图像纹理”节点,连接到“基础色”。
  6. 选择图像,为杯子添加颜色或图案。

3.3 渲染基础

渲染是将 3D 场景转换为 2D 图像的过程。Blender 支持 Cycles 和 Eevee 两种渲染引擎。

Cycles:基于物理的光线追踪渲染器,质量高但速度慢。 Eevee:实时渲染器,速度快但质量较低。

渲染设置:

  1. 在属性面板中,点击“渲染”图标。
  2. 选择渲染引擎(Cycles 或 Eevee)。
  3. 调整采样设置(Cycles):增加采样数以提高质量。
  4. 设置输出分辨率和格式。
  5. 按 F12 键渲染。

示例:渲染杯子

  1. 为杯子添加材质(如陶瓷材质)。
  2. 添加灯光:按 Shift + A > Light > Area Light,调整位置和强度。
  3. 调整相机:按 N 键打开侧边栏,在“视图”选项卡中,调整相机位置。
  4. 选择渲染引擎为 Cycles。
  5. 按 F12 键渲染,查看效果。

第四部分:精通 Blender

4.1 高级建模技术

精通 Blender 需要掌握高级建模技术,如硬表面建模、有机建模和程序化建模。

硬表面建模:用于机械、建筑等硬质物体。

  • 使用布尔修改器组合几何体。
  • 使用倒角和细分曲面创建平滑边缘。
  • 使用阵列和镜像创建对称结构。

有机建模:用于角色、动物等生物。

  • 使用雕刻建模创建基础形状。
  • 使用多边形建模添加细节。
  • 使用重拓扑(Retopology)优化几何体。

程序化建模:使用节点创建几何体。

  • 使用几何节点(Geometry Nodes)创建程序化模型。
  • 使用节点组创建可重复使用的模型。

示例:使用几何节点创建程序化楼梯

  1. 创建一个新场景,删除默认对象。
  2. 在属性面板中,点击“修改器”图标,添加“几何节点”修改器。
  3. 在几何节点编辑器中,添加节点:
    • “网格立方体”节点:创建台阶。
    • “实例化于点上”节点:将台阶实例化到点上。
    • “网格到点”节点:生成点阵列。
    • “设置位置”节点:调整点的位置。
  4. 连接节点,调整参数,创建楼梯。

4.2 动画基础

动画是 Blender 的强大功能之一,可以创建角色动画、物体运动等。

关键概念:

  • 关键帧(Keyframe):在特定时间点设置对象的属性(如位置、旋转、缩放)。
  • 曲线编辑器(Graph Editor):调整动画曲线,控制运动速度。
  • 约束(Constraints):限制对象的运动,如“跟随路径”、“复制位置”等。

示例:创建一个简单的弹跳球动画

  1. 创建一个球体(Shift + A > Mesh > Sphere)。
  2. 在时间轴上,将当前帧设置为 1。
  3. 选择球体,按 G 键移动到起始位置,按 I 键插入关键帧,选择“位置”。
  4. 将当前帧设置为 24,移动球体到地面,插入关键帧。
  5. 将当前帧设置为 48,移动球体到最高点,插入关键帧。
  6. 将当前帧设置为 72,移动球体到地面,插入关键帧。
  7. 打开曲线编辑器(Window > Animation > Graph Editor),调整曲线,使球体弹跳更自然。

4.3 材质与着色器

高级材质和着色器可以创建逼真的表面效果。

节点基础:

  • 基础色(Base Color):物体的颜色。
  • 金属度(Metallic):控制金属感。
  • 粗糙度(Roughness):控制表面粗糙度。
  • 法线贴图(Normal Map):增加表面细节。

示例:创建一个金属材质

  1. 选择对象,新建材质。
  2. 在着色器编辑器中,添加“原理化 BSDF”节点。
  3. 调整参数:
    • 基础色:深灰色(RGB: 0.1, 0.1, 0.1)。
    • 金属度:1.0。
    • 粗糙度:0.2。
  4. 添加“噪波纹理”节点,连接到“粗糙度”。
  5. 调整噪波纹理的尺度和细节,创建不均匀的金属表面。

4.4 渲染与后期处理

高级渲染涉及灯光、环境和后期处理。

灯光设置:

  • 三点照明:主光、补光和背光。
  • HDRI 环境光:使用 HDR 图像提供全局照明。
  • 体积光:创建雾、烟雾等效果。

后期处理:

  • 在合成器中,使用节点进行颜色校正、添加景深等。
  • 使用“胶片”节点调整对比度和饱和度。

示例:渲染一个场景

  1. 创建一个场景,包含多个对象(如杯子、桌子、书本)。
  2. 设置三点照明:主光(区域光)、补光(弱光)、背光(点光)。
  3. 添加 HDRI 环境光:在世界属性中,添加“环境纹理”节点,连接到“背景”。
  4. 调整相机:设置景深,对焦到杯子。
  5. 渲染设置:选择 Cycles 引擎,采样 256,分辨率 1920x1080。
  6. 渲染后,进入合成器,添加“颜色平衡”节点调整颜色,添加“模糊”节点模拟景深。

第五部分:学习资源与进阶建议

5.1 学习资源

  • 官方文档Blender Manual
  • 在线教程
    • Blender Guru(YouTube 频道):适合初学者。
    • CG Cookie:提供系统课程。
    • FlippedNormals:专注于角色建模。
  • 社区
    • Blender Artists 论坛:提问和分享作品。
    • Reddit 的 r/blender 社区。

5.2 进阶建议

  1. 每天练习:即使只有 30 分钟,持续练习是进步的关键。
  2. 参与项目:尝试创建完整的项目,如短片、游戏资产或产品可视化。
  3. 学习插件:掌握常用插件,如 Hard Ops(硬表面建模)、Sculpting Tools(雕刻工具)。
  4. 关注行业趋势:了解 Blender 在电影、游戏、建筑等领域的应用。
  5. 分享作品:在社交媒体或社区分享作品,获取反馈。

5.3 常见问题与解决方案

  • 问题:Blender 运行缓慢。
    • 解决方案:降低细分级别,使用 Eevee 渲染,优化几何体。
  • 问题:UV 展开困难。
    • 解决方案:使用“智能 UV 投影”或手动展开,避免重叠。
  • 问题:渲染噪点多。
    • 解决方案:增加采样数,使用降噪器,调整灯光强度。

结语

掌握 Blender 需要时间和耐心,但通过系统性的学习和实践,你可以从入门到精通。本指南涵盖了从基础操作到高级技巧的各个方面,希望对你有所帮助。记住,Blender 是一个不断发展的工具,保持学习和探索的热情,你将能够创造出令人惊叹的三维作品。开始你的 Blender 之旅吧!